Wanted: Immigration, Police move against former Governor, Yahaya Bello

Former Governor of Kogi state, Yahaya Bello has been placed on watch-list of the Nigeria Immigration Service to prevent him from leaving the country.

Immigration authorities have also written to the Department of State Services, DSS, Nigeria Police Force, Nigeria Intelligence Agency, and other law enforcement agencies in the country to notify them that the 2023 Presidential aspirant of the All Progressives Congress, APC is now on the no-fly list

The letter signed by the Assistant Comptroller of Immigration, D.S Umar, says the former Governor is being prosecuted at the Federal High Court, Abuja for conspiracy, breach of trust and money laundering.

The Nigerian Immigration Service says if former Governor Bello is seen at any entry or exit point in the country he should be arrested and referred to the Director of Investigation.

Meanwhile, the Inspector-General of Police, Kayode Egbetokun, has ordered the Assistant Inspector-General of Police in charge of the Police Mobile Force, PMF to withdraw all personnel attached to Yahaya Bello who has been declared wanted by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C.

In a wireless message cited by AIT.live, MOPOL 37 Lokoja is directed to strictly comply with the order.
